What are examples of environmental impacts?

Environmental impacts encompass a wide range of consequences resulting from human activities that affect the natural world. Examples of environmental impacts include deforestation, air and water pollution, habitat destruction, climate change, loss of biodiversity, and soil degradation. These impacts can have far-reaching effects on ecosystems, wildlife, human health, and the overall health of the planet. It is crucial for individuals and organisations to be aware of these impacts and take proactive steps to minimise their negative effects through sustainable practices and conservation efforts.

What are 3 common types of environmental impact?

Three common types of environmental impact include air pollution, water pollution, and deforestation. Air pollution, caused by emissions from vehicles, industries, and other sources, contributes to respiratory problems and climate change. Water pollution, often from industrial waste and agricultural runoff, harms aquatic ecosystems and endangers human health. Deforestation, the clearing of forests for agriculture or development, disrupts biodiversity and contributes to climate change. Addressing these environmental impacts requires collective efforts to reduce emissions, improve waste management practices, and promote sustainable land use.
